机械加工编程是什么意思
-
机械加工编程是指在机械加工过程中,根据产品图纸和加工要求,利用计算机编程软件,将其转化为机械加工代码的过程。它是一种将设计图纸中的几何形状和加工参数转化为机械设备所能理解的指令语言的技术。
机械加工编程的目的是将设计图纸中的几何形状、尺寸、加工工艺等信息转化为具体的加工指令,以便机械设备能够按照这些指令进行自动加工。通过机械加工编程,可以实现对零件的高效、精确加工,提高生产效率和产品质量。
机械加工编程的过程包括以下几个步骤:
-
分析产品图纸和加工要求:对产品图纸进行仔细分析,了解零件的几何形状、尺寸、加工工艺等信息,并根据加工要求确定加工顺序和工艺路线。
-
创建工艺模型:根据产品图纸和加工要求,利用机械加工编程软件创建工艺模型,包括零件的几何形状、尺寸、加工工艺等信息。在创建工艺模型时,可以选择合适的加工工艺和刀具。
-
编写加工代码:根据工艺模型和机械设备的加工要求,编写加工代码。加工代码包括刀具路径、切削参数、进给速度、切削深度等信息,它们将被机械设备识别和执行。
-
机械设备设置:将编写好的加工代码输入到机械设备的控制系统中,并进行设备的设置和调试,确保机械设备能够按照要求正确执行加工工艺。
-
加工调试:进行加工调试,通过实际加工测试,检查零件的加工质量和尺寸精度,如有需要,进行参数调整和修正,直到满足加工要求为止。
机械加工编程的实施需要一定的专业知识和技能,编程人员需要具备机械加工和计算机编程的双重技能。通过合理的编程,可以实现机械加工过程的高度自动化和智能化,提高生产效率和产品质量。
1年前 -
-
机械加工编程是一种通过编写指令来控制机械加工设备进行加工操作的过程。它是将需要加工的零件的几何特征和加工参数转化为机器能够理解和执行的指令的过程。
具体来说,机械加工编程包括以下几个方面:
1.机械加工编程语言:机械加工编程语言是一种特定的语言,用于编写机械加工设备的加工程序。常见的机械加工编程语言包括G代码和M代码。G代码主要描述加工轨迹和运动方式,而M代码则描述非运动性指令,如启动和停止等。
2.几何建模和零件描述:在机械加工编程中,首先需要对需要加工的零件进行几何建模和描述。这可以通过CAD软件来完成,通过绘制零件的实体模型和定义几何特征来描述零件的形状和尺寸。
3.加工参数和程序规划:在机械加工编程中,还需要确定加工参数,包括切削速度、进给速度、切削深度等。同时,还需要规划加工程序的先后顺序和运动路径,以确保零件能够按照要求进行加工。
4.CAM软件:为了简化机械加工编程的复杂度,提高效率,常常使用计算机辅助制造(Computer Aided Manufacturing, CAM)软件。CAM软件可以根据零件的几何特征和加工参数,自动生成机械加工程序。
5.机械加工设备的控制:机械加工编程最终的目的是通过将编写好的加工程序输入到机械加工设备的控制系统中,实现对设备的精确控制。这些控制系统可以是数控系统(Numerical Control Systems, CNC),能够自动控制机械加工中的各项参数,如切削速度、进给速度和刀具位置等。
总之,机械加工编程是将需要加工的零件的几何特征和加工参数转化为机械加工设备能够理解和执行的指令的过程。它涉及到几何建模、加工参数设定、程序规划和机械加工设备的控制等多个方面。
1年前 -
机械加工编程是指将工件的几何形状和加工工艺参数通过计算机编程的方式转化为机床可以识别和执行的指令。在机械加工过程中,通过编程可以实现自动化、高效率和高精度的加工操作。
机械加工编程通常包括以下几个方面:
-
加工对象的几何形状描述:编程需要提供被加工工件的几何形状描述,通常采用CAD软件进行绘制,通过创建线条、曲线、圆弧等几何元素来描述工件轮廓。
-
加工工艺参数的设定:编程还需要确定加工工艺参数,如加工刀具的尺寸、加工速度、进给速度、进给量、切削深度等。这些参数将直接影响到加工效果和工件的精度。
-
生成加工路径:通过编程,可以根据加工对象的几何形状和工艺参数,计算出机床在加工过程中需要沿着的路径。这个路径包括了切削轮廓、补偿路径、补偿量等信息。
-
生成机床指令:通过编程,可以将加工路径转化为机床可以识别和执行的指令,通常使用G代码或M代码进行表示。G代码用来表示加工路径,包括直线、圆弧等运动指令;M代码用来表示机床的辅助功能,如启动、停止、冷却等。
-
模拟和验证:编程完成后,还需要进行仿真和验证,以确保加工路径和指令的准确性和合理性。这可以通过专门的软件进行模拟和验证,以避免在实际加工过程中出现问题。
总结起来,机械加工编程是将工件的几何形状和加工工艺参数通过计算机编程转化为机床可以识别和执行的指令的过程。通过编程,可以实现自动化、高效率和高精度的机械加工过程。
1年前 -